Dr. Lauren Silver’s article, “Urban School Formation: Identity Work and Constructing an Origin Story,” was recently published in The Urban Review. The article ethnographically traces the identity work involved in establishing Shearwater High School, a charter school to reengage youth who had dropped out of St. Louis Public Schools.

New article by Dr. Kate Cairns published in Gender and Education.
Dr. Kate Cairns recently published an article in Gender and Education entitled “Both here and elsewhere: Rural girls’ contradictory visions of the future.” Drawing upon ethnographic research in a rural elementary school in Ontario, Canada, Dr. Cairns brings an analysis of place to debates about gendered subjectivity formation. Eva Lupold recently accepted for publication in Girlhood Studies 7.2 (Winter 2014)

Eva’s article, “Adolescence in Action: Screening Narratives of Girl Killers,” argues that action-adventure films featuring tween and teenage girls are becoming increasingly popular due to cultural anxieties over changes in nuclear family structures, as well as recent shifts in cultural attitudes towards girlhood sexuality and aggression.
